Write a short paragraph on The Kashmir Valley.
The Kashmir Valley.
1)
Jammu and Kashmir are a Union Territory in India.
2)
It has two capitals; Jammu and Sri Nagar.
3)
For its natural beauty, it is called heaven on earth.
4)
Kashmiri, Dogri and Urdu are the main languages of Jammu and Kashmir.
5)
Jammu and Kashmir are mainly divided into three parts; Jammu, Kashmir and
Ladakh.
6)
The “Pashmina Shawl” of Kashmir is famous in the whole World.
7)
Jammu and Kashmir have the majority of the Muslim population.
8)
The Ladakh part of Jammu and Kashmir has the majority of Buddhists.
9)
The people of Jammu and Kashmir mainly depend on farming and agriculture.
10) It is a tourism spot for people from all around the world.
